Step 1: In a small bowl, combine the spices. Rub spice mixture onto the chicken. Place in resealable plastic bag and refrigerate overnight. (I usually skip this step because I don't plan ahead).
Step 2: When ready to cook, put chopped onion in bottom of crock pot. Add chicken. No liquid is needed, the chicken will make it's own juices. Cook on low 4-8 hours. Note: I highly recommend a pop-up timer in the chicken because some crock pots cook faster/slower than others (my crock pot cooks this recipe in 4-5 hours).
